Ingredients:

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 6 oz/170g each)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il (15 ml)
  • 1 teaspoon dried Italian seasoning (5 ml)
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der (2.5 ml)
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
  • 1 pint cherry tomatoes, halved (about 300g)
  • 8 ounces fresh mozzarella cheese, sliced (about 225g)
  • 1/4 cup fresh basil leaves, roughly chopped (about 15g)
  • 1/4 cup balsamic glaze (store-bought or homemade) (60ml)
  • Fresh basil sprigs (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Pound chicken breasts to an even thickness (about ½ inch). This ensures even cooking.
  2. In a small bowl, combine olive oil, Italian seasoning,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Rub the mixture all over the chicken breasts.
  3.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the seasoned chicken and sear for 5-7 minutes per side, or until cooked through and golden brown.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C).
  4. While the chicken is still in the skillet (or after transferring to a baking sheet), top each chicken breast with sliced mozzarella and halved cherry tomatoes.
  5. Cover the skillet (or place baking sheet under the broiler) and cook until the mozzarella is melted and bubbly, about 2-3 minutes. Watch carefully to prevent burning!
  6. Remove from heat and sprinkle with fresh basil leaves. Drizzle with balsamic glaze. Garnish with fresh basil sprigs, if desired. Serve immediately. Enjoy your Chicken Caprese!
